Distributed Cluster Computing on Cell/PS3Akira Tsukamoto (akira-t@s9.dion.ne.jp)The PS3 BOF will discuss topics of Folding@Home distributed computing for PS3, status of PS3 patches included in mainline kernel and Internet booting technology enhanced by Cell. Cell CPU is designed as a heterogeneous multi-core processor which consists of one hyper threaded Power Processor Element (PPE), PowerPC compatible core, and seven Synergistic Processor Elements (SPEs), vector processing cores. The Folding@home project which was introduced on March ‘07 is one of an application to utilize the Cell architecture for PS3 users. From programmer perspective, PS3 Linux is the only environment providing to practice distributed parallel programming. When circumstances allow, discussion will involve booting PS3 Linux through Internet with SPE assisted user space device driver. | |||||
